Maison >interface Web >tutoriel CSS >Comment obtenir un débordement de texte multiligne avec Ellipsis en CSS ?
Débordement de texte multiligne avec points de suspension
En CSS, la propriété text-overflow permet de tronquer le texte lorsqu'il dépasse la zone désignée. Cependant, par défaut, cette troncature s'effectue sur une seule ligne. Parfois, il est souhaitable de permettre au texte de s'enrouler sur plusieurs lignes tout en indiquant qu'il y a plus à voir.
Réaliser un débordement multiligne avec des points de suspension
Pour obtenir cet effet , nous pouvons utiliser les propriétés CSS suivantes :
Exemple d'utilisation
div { width: 300px; height: 42px; display: -webkit-box; -webkit-line-clamp: 3; -webkit-box-orient: vertical; overflow: hidden; text-overflow: ellipsis; }
Avec ces propriétés en place, le texte dans la ligne
Remarque : Ces propriétés ne sont prises en charge que par WebKit. navigateurs, y compris Chrome et Safari. D'autres navigateurs peuvent nécessiter des solutions alternatives.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!